House prices, disposable income and permanent and temporary shocks: The NZ, UK and US experience
Available to Purchase
Journal of European Real Estate Research (2012) 5 (1): 5–28.
Published: 04 May 2012
... and deterministic components. Design/methodology/approach Using quarterly data over 1973‐2008, two‐variable systems of house prices and income are specified for three major house‐owning economies: New Zealand (NZ), the United Kingdom (UK) and the United States of America (USA).
